Bradley has been sidelined since picking up a knock against Crystal Palace on April 14, while Jota sustained an issue during last Sunday’s win at Fulham.
However, while taking positive steps towards their returns, both will continue their recovery programmes this weekend and will not be available for tomorrow’s visit to West Ham United.
Klopp said: “Both not ready. Progressing well, [but] not ready and nobody told me yet they will start training in the next few days. I think it will take time, a little bit.”
